Abstract

Instance documents related to policy enforcement are gathered according to a business requirement. The instance documents are instantiated from corresponding schema documents. An instantiated context model, including references to the gathered instance documents, is generated from a context model definition. A policy set to be enforced using the instantiated context model is generated according to the gathered instance documents. An enforcement sequence of policies in the policy set is determined. The policies are applied to the instantiated context model according to the enforcement sequence.
